Single joint equipment couplings are utilized to link two nominally coaxial shafts. In this software the device is referred to as a equipment-sort adaptable, or adaptable coupling. The single joint permits for slight misalignments these kinds of as installation glitches and modifications in shaft alignment thanks to operating situations. These sorts of equipment couplings are typically limited to angular misalignments of 1/4 to 1/2°.

Equipment couplings ordinarily occur in two versions, flanged sleeve and continuous sleeve. Flanged gear couplings consist of short sleeves surrounded by a perpendicular flange. One sleeve is placed on every single shaft so the two flanges line up confront to experience. A sequence of screws or bolts in the flanges keep them collectively. Ongoing sleeve gear couplings feature shaft finishes coupled with each other and abutted from each and every other, which are then enveloped by a sleeve. Usually, these sleeves are made of metallic, but they can also be produced of Nylon.

Each joint normally is made up of a 1:one equipment ratio interior/external equipment pair. The tooth flanks and outer diameter of the exterior equipment are topped to allow for angular displacement in between the two gears. Mechanically, the gears are equivalent to rotating splines with modified profiles. They are called gears simply because of the relatively big dimensions of the teeth. Equipment couplings are normally constrained to angular misalignments of 4 to 5°.
